Resumo

A significant bend loss reduction for z-cut Ti:LiNbO/sub 3/ waveguides was achieved with a single and very efficient technique. The refractive index on the outer sides of an S bend was decreased through indiffusion of a double-MgO layer for reducing the radiation losses, and a broadening of the bent waveguide sections was used for further decreasing of the radiation losses and additionally reducing the transition losses. The acceptable bend radius for an allowed excess loss of 1 dB could thus be reduced from 24 mm down to 5 mm for TM polarization and from 26 mm down to 10 mm for TE polarization. >
